Michael's job/research description: My past work has centered on presence/absence mist-netting surveys for T & E's, primarily the Indiana bat, while evaluating habitat for same and identifying all bats captured during surveys. Such work has been conducted in IL, IN, KY, OH, MI, and TN. Current efforts are directed toward protecting a gray bat nursery cave from flooding (as much as possible) at a Corps project in KY. In addition to presence/absence surveys, future work will involve additional protection for this cave, a survey of other caves on Corps property for protective measures or controls, and negotiations with the Bloomington Field Office of the USFWS regarding protective measures for gray bats relating to closure and reuse of the Indiana Army Ammunition Plant in southern Indiana.
